Robert,

> > As a thought, is it worth mentioning that there'll be a "commercial
> > grade" proper Open Source PostgreSQL replication system available
> > simultaneous to the 7.4 release?  It's one of those things that is often
> > asked about in higher-end installations, so letting people know in the
> > press release (widest possible audience) makes sense.
>
> I'd rather spin it off as its own press release...

Hmmm ... don't think I agree.  The donation of eRServer is our "sexiest"
feature for 7.4, and one of 3-4 items to make the press pay attention to the
release.

Also, if we send two releases within 2 weeks of each other,
1) Most reporters won't read them both, and
2) we won't get both of them together in time.

But I'm willing to be persuaded, especially if you/somebody has text prepared
for a release around eRServer that will go out this week.
